Our Office

888 Oak Grove Ave. Suite 9, Menlo Park, CA 94025

650-322-2817

Office Hours:
Wednesday/Thursday: 9:00 a.m. - 5:00 p.m.

 
 

Contact Us

We look forward to hearing from you.


Direct Email (or send email via contact form):


morrill@stanford.edu